As far as I have been able to determine, serger needles and machine needles are two different critters UNLESS your manual specifically says that it takes regular machine needles. Google the make and model, and try to find a source online - you have a better chance of finding it there than locally. Also, if you get them mailed to you, you don't have to pay a long trip to some obscure part of town during shop hours, so...
